### Runbook fragment — Pondside pool rollout

Quick note for the security reviewer: we're bumping the connection pool on the Bramblewood API from 20 to 60 per node, with idle reaping at 90 seconds. Pool credentials are minted short-lived by the Gatehouse broker, so nothing long-lived sits in config. The rollout manifest itself is signed, and nodes reject unsigned manifests outright. The manifests for this release are signed with the key below.

signing key of bagap-yawep = bky13_TbfT6ZMUoGJo2

The Ledgerfern CI suite began failing on tax-rate lookup tests after the cache warmer started pulling stale region tables. Root cause: the cache keys omit the schedule version, so a mid-run rate update poisons entries for the rest of the job. Workaround: clear the shared cache volume before the fixture stage, or set the warmer to bypass mode. A proper key fix is planned. The failing run's identifier is recorded below.

pipeline stamp: htk6_c0ef30

Release checklist — Soundloom 2.7, waveform preview module. Heads up, future maintainers: the preview renderer now caches peaks files per upload, so double-check that the cache eviction job is actually enabled before shipping (it was silently off in 2.6 and disk filled up fast). Also verify the preview degrades gracefully for files over two hours — we clamp resolution rather than erroring out now. Smoke-test with the long-podcast fixture in the seed bucket. The artifact you should be testing carries the build token printed just below.

pipeline stamp: htk9_ce63042d9

Step 4 — Locale rollout for Datewise

Quick one for the sync: before deploying Datewise 3.2, make sure the formatter pulls region patterns from the Calindra service instead of the bundled table. Flip DATE_SOURCE=remote in the deploy env and bump LOCALE_CACHE_TTL to 3600. The Calindra fetch needs auth, so put the service secret on the next line.

sealed setting: ARCHIVE_KEY3=8d0